Sure, that’s faster. But do you really care? How big is your data? How many distinct things are you counting? What are their data types? All that matters. It’s easy to write a simple for-loop and say “It’s faster.” Most of the time, it doesn’t matter that much. When that’s the case, Clojure allows you to operate at a higher level with inherent thread safety. If you figure out that this particular code matters, then Clojure gives you the ability to optimize it, either with transients or by dropping down into Java interop where you have standard Java mutable arrays and other data structures at your disposal. When you use Java interop, you give up the safety of Clojure’s immutable data structures, but you can write code that is more optimized to your particular problem. I’ll be honest that I’ve never had to do that. But it’s nice to know that it’s there.
